Is eating betel nut good for health?

However, modern research shows many health risks associated with the practice. Regular chewing of the betel nut has been linked to cancer of the mouth and esophagus, oral submucous fibrosis, and tooth decay. The WHO has classified betel nut as a carcinogen and initiated an action plan to reduce its use.

How do I get rid of betel nut addiction?

Betel nut addiction could be treated by the same, simple drugs used to wean people off cigarettes, a study has found. Research on the stimulation caused by the popular custom of chewing betel nuts shows the nut’s psychoactive chemicals affect the same brain regions as nicotine.

How much betel nut is safe?

But betel nut is LIKELY UNSAFE when taken long-term or in high doses. Some of the chemicals in betel nut have been associated with cancer. Other chemicals are poisonous. Eating 8-30 grams of betel nut can cause death.

Is Supari banned in India?

A government resolution, issued on July 20, renewed the ban on gutka, paan masala and supari that is either flavoured, scented or mixed with additives. Tobacco use is the foremost preventable cause of death and disease, globally as well as in India.

Is Supari harmful for health?

BANGALORE: Chewing betelnut is not injurious to health, the Karnataka High Court ruled on Wednesday. In a major relief to beleaguered arecanut growers and the state’s arecanut industry, the court ruled that chewing of arecanut or supari is not injurious to health and that arecanut products need not carry the warning.
